The Journey Begins: Pickup and Transport

The journey starts early, typically around 6:00 or 6:30 AM, with hotel pickups in Pokhara or Kathmandu. This early start means you’ll need to be ready and eager for a long day ahead, but the promise of wildlife sights makes it worthwhile. The bus ride is about 5 to 7 hours, depending on traffic, and offers scenic views of Nepal’s rural landscape. We appreciated the smooth transportation, as it removes the headache of planning and navigating ourselves.

Arrival in Chitwan: Check-in and Lunch

Once in Chitwan, you’ll check into the Rainbow Safari Resort, which is designed for comfort and convenience. The included lunch is hearty and gives you energy for the afternoon activities. It’s worth noting that the hotel and accommodations receive positive remarks for their helpful staff and clean rooms, making the overnight stay enjoyable.

The Jungle Safari Experience

After settling in, the real highlight begins — the guided jeep safari in Chitwan National Park. The safari is led by knowledgeable guides, which, according to reviews, is a key part of the experience. As you traverse the park’s lush terrain, keep your eyes peeled for Bengal tigers, one-horned rhinos, and a diverse bird population. One traveler noted that animals like crocodiles, langurs, macaques, and sloth bears are often spotted, and the guide’s expertise helps increase your chances of sightings.

The safari is a balance of excitement and education, with guides explaining wildlife habits and park ecology in ways that make the experience engaging. We loved the way the guides enhanced the safari with their detailed knowledge, making each animal encounter more meaningful.

Cultural Highlights: Tharu Dance and Village Visit

In the evening, the tour introduces you to Tharu culture, with a lively dance performance at a traditional village. The Tharu dance is colorful, energetic, and offers a glimpse into local customs. As one reviewer noted, the dance performance is “mesmerizing,” and provides a nice cultural pause after a busy day in the wild.

Early Morning Wildlife Walk

The next morning kicks off with an early guided jungle walk, which offers one last chance to see flora and fauna before heading back. This walk is often praised for the knowledgeable guides who help identify plants and animals, adding depth to the experience.

Returning Home: Relaxed and Satisfied

After breakfast, you’ll depart around 7:00 AM for the journey back to Pokhara or Kathmandu. The return trip wraps up the experience, leaving you with memorable wildlife sightings and cultural impressions.

One reviewer, Gabriel, shared that “the jungle safari drive and river cruise” were the highlights, and noted that two days wasn’t enough to see everything. They saw two types of crocodiles, rhinos, langurs, macaques, and sloth bears, which underscores how rich the park’s wildlife can be.
